1. Read  this conversation about CHARITY


  • Is that a Red Cross Pin?

  • Yes, I always give money every year when they have their fundraisers. I think they do a great job.

  • That’s true. I don’t have much money, so I don’t always give to charity. I gave some money to charity that works with street children.

  • Well, in my opinion there are too many people asking for money. It’s hard to say ‘yes’ to everybody.
  • I agree and then if there’s a disaster, such as the earthquake in Haiti or the hurricanes en Tabasco and Chiapas, they try to raise money, too.
  • I think the government has the major responsibility, but sometimes it can’t handle everything.

  • Right.  I think it’s important to give to charity if possible, but each of us must think about our families and our own financial situation first.

  •  Hmm. I don’t agree. Sometimes it’s important to help people. If we always think about ourselves first, no one will help others in need.

  • Maybe you’re right.
